Par strikes $65M licensing deal for antifungal therapy

Tools

Par Pharmaceutical has agreed to pay up to $65 million to license the U.S. rights to the antifungal therapy Loramyc from France's BioAlliance Pharma. The drug is in late-stage trials for oropharyngeal candidiasis, an infection common among immunocompromised patients. BioAlliance gets $15 million up front, another $20 million on the FDA's approval and up to $30 million in scheduled milestones. The drug has already been approved in France. BioAlliance has a 50-50 joint venture deal to commercialize the drug in the rest of Europe with SpeBio.
